在技术飞速发展的今天,开发者的工具库变得愈加重要。而在这个工具库中,一些冷门的GitHub软件往往能够提供意想不到的便利,提升工作效率。本文将为您详细介绍几款冷门却强大的GitHub软件。
一、为什么要关注冷门GitHub软件?
- 新颖性:冷门软件通常不受大众关注,功能可能更具创意和创新性。
- 独特性:这些工具往往能够填补市面上主流工具的不足之处,提供独特的解决方案。
- 学习机会:使用这些软件可以帮助开发者拓宽视野,了解更广泛的技术应用场景。
二、冷门GitHub软件推荐
1. Pico-8
- 项目链接: Pico-8
- 功能介绍:Pico-8是一个虚拟游戏机,旨在激发创意和快速开发。开发者可以通过简单的编程语言快速制作2D游戏。
- 使用场景:适合游戏开发爱好者、学生和独立开发者。
2. Gogs
- 项目链接: Gogs
- 功能介绍:Gogs是一个轻量级的自托管Git服务,提供了简单、快速的安装体验,适合小团队使用。
- 使用场景:在内部网络环境下,想要创建私有代码仓库的开发团队。
3. BookStack
- 项目链接: BookStack
- 功能介绍:BookStack是一个开源的文档管理系统,帮助团队集中存储和分享知识。用户可以轻松创建、编辑和管理文档。
- 使用场景:适合团队协作、文档管理、知识分享等场景。
4. Rambox
- 项目链接: Rambox
- 功能介绍:Rambox是一个跨平台的消息与邮件聚合应用,支持多种通讯软件,极大地方便用户集中管理各类社交媒体与邮件。
- 使用场景:对需要同时使用多款通讯工具的用户非常实用。
5. TiddlyWiki
- 项目链接: TiddlyWiki
- 功能介绍:TiddlyWiki是一个高度可定制的个人维基笔记,用户可以自由添加内容和模块,满足个性化需求。
- 使用场景:适合希望进行知识管理和个人笔记的开发者。
三、如何选择冷门GitHub软件?
选择冷门软件时,可以考虑以下几点:
- 功能需求:明确您的具体需求,寻找符合这些需求的工具。
- 社区支持:检查该项目的社区活跃程度和支持情况,确保在遇到问题时能够获得帮助。
- 更新频率:定期更新的软件通常具有更好的安全性和功能完善性。
四、冷门GitHub软件的使用心得
- 灵活性:冷门软件通常灵活多变,能满足各种特定需求。
- 用户体验:许多冷门工具虽然不够成熟,但在细节上可能更加注重用户体验。
- 创新性:使用冷门工具,可以激发思维,带来意想不到的开发灵感。
五、常见问题解答(FAQ)
1. 冷门GitHub软件安全吗?
使用开源软件时,您需要注意以下几点:
- 查看项目的更新记录和社区反馈。
- 阅读代码和文档,确认其安全性。
2. 如何为冷门GitHub软件贡献代码?
- 首先,了解该项目的贡献指南。
- 创建fork,进行修改后提交Pull Request。
3. 冷门GitHub软件如何提高开发效率?
- 提供独特功能,减少依赖于主流工具的局限性。
- 可能针对特定问题提供更加简洁有效的解决方案。
4. 在哪里可以找到更多冷门GitHub软件?
- 您可以通过GitHub的搜索功能,使用关键词查找,或者参考GitHub trending页面。
5. 冷门软件是否适合新手?
- 某些冷门软件具有较高的学习曲线,不太适合完全的新手。但许多工具在界面和功能上非常友好,可以尝试。
结论
在GitHub这个庞大的开源世界中,冷门软件为开发者提供了丰富的选择。这些工具虽然不为大众所熟知,但却可以极大提升开发效率和工作体验。希望本文能帮助您发现更多有趣的GitHub项目,丰富您的开发工具库。
正文完